Abstract

The root part between teeth of the conical internal thread is a centering slope surface, the large-diameter end at the upper part of the centering slope surface is a centering surface in interference fit with the crest of the external conical thread, the included angle beta between the centering slope surface and a main conical surface is more than 0 and less than alpha, and alpha is the inclination angle of the main conical surface. The root between the conical inner thread teeth adopts a double-conical surface structure with a centering slope surface to form a full-thread spiral interference surface, the size of the spiral interference surface can be adjusted by adjusting the tight distance so as to meet the requirement of working conditions, and the load is uniformly distributed on the full length of the thread due to the generation of the full-thread spiral interference surface; a self-locking spiral surface is formed, and the anti-loosening performance is excellent; the transverse vibration resistance is excellent, and the device can cope with frequent vibration and alternating load; abrasion and fatigue fracture are not easy to cause; the detachable type screw driver is suitable for frequent disassembly, only changes the internal thread and can be interchanged with the original product.

Technical field
The present invention relates to a kind of screw thread, particularly a kind of button-type is the conical internal thread of triangle, trapezoidal, sawtooth pattern etc., is mainly used in drilling rod, oil pipe, sleeve pipe and the non-excavation drilling rod etc. of oil, geologic prospecting and exploitation.
Background technique
Tapered thread is the necessary mode of product transferring power such as the drilling rod, oil pipe, sleeve pipe, non-excavation drilling rod of oil, geologic prospecting and exploitation usefulness and medium, drilling rod, oil pipe, sleeve pipe connect by the end tapered thread, come transferring power, fed sheet of a media etc., traditional tapered thread such as API screw thread, geology screw thread are determined thread size by effective diameter of thread, it is Spielpassung that the screw pair Major Diam that forms cooperates, and guarantees by effective diameter of thread; The wire line coring drill rod thread adopts the centering of big footpath, and its common drawback is: the self-locking area is little, and anti-loosing effect is poor, load distribution is inhomogeneous, bears the frequent transverse vibration and the ability of alternating stress, and wearing and tearing and fracture easily take place at the screw thread position, especially wire line coring drilling rod wall is thin, have to adopt short tooth steep-pitch thread, it is relatively large again to bear moment of torsion, and screw thread adopts the centering of big footpath, the major part interference, the microcephaly gap, discontinuity, shortcoming is more outstanding.
